>>> *Summary*
>>> The Web Authentication API specifies a series of webdriver commands to
>>> support testing. These commands set up "virtual authenticators" that behave
>>> as if they were connected to the user agent and can service WebAuthn
>>> operations. https://github.com/w3c/webauthn/pull/2382 introduced two
>>> changes related to signature counters:
>>> * The Add Credential command can now take a null `signCount` parameter.
>>> This specifies that the virtual authenticator will set the signature
>>> counter to zero on every subsequent get assertion operation, matching the
>>> behaviour of synced passkey providers.
>>> * A new `signCount` parameter to the Set Credential Properties command
>>> that lets callers override the signature counter on the authenticator to
>>> test simulated duplicated authenticators.
>>>
>>> We are requesting permission to ship these webdriver-only changes.
>>> Webdriver classic is a little special in that there doesn't seem to be a
>>> sane way to flag guard the changes (and developers can set whatever flags
>>> they want anyway!). Thus, in attempting to follow the exciting webdriver WP
>>> launch process, we are asking for permission *before *landing any code.
